Interboro had to skate by with only a two-run margin when they last took the field, which might have inspired the ten-run drubbing they dealt Chichester on Tuesday. The Buccaneers were the clear victors by a 12-2 margin over the Eagles. Considering the Buccaneers have won ten matches by more than seven runs this season, Tuesday's blowout was nothing new.
Aubrey MacWilliams was a standout: she went 1-for-2 with one home run and five RBI. Summer Burrell was another key player, getting on base in three of her four plate appearances with three stolen bases and three runs.
Interboro pushed their record up to 15-2 with the victory, which was their sixth straight on the road. Those road w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 14.0 runs over those games. As for Chichester, they moved to 8-8 with that defeat, which also ended their three-game winning streak.
